TB-500 is a synthetic peptide that replicates the active site of Thymosin Beta-4 (Tβ4), a protein found in nearly every cell of the human body. Its primary biological role is the regulation of actin, a vital protein for cell structure and movement.When an injury occurs, the body naturally releases Tβ4 to the site of damage. TB-500 amplifies this natural response by providing a concentrated, bioavailable version of the protein's most potent regenerative segment.
The magic of TB-500 lies in its ability to facilitate cell migration. By regulating the polymerization and depolymerization of actin, it allows repair cells to move more efficiently to the site of injury. Furthermore, it is a powerful driver of angiogenesis—the formation of new blood vessels. This ensures that the injured area receives an increased supply of oxygen and nutrients, which is often the limiting factor in the healing of poorly vascularized tissues like tendons and ligaments.
